Who or what inspired you to work in sustainability?

Since choosing to study geography at higher education I have appreciated the need of looking at issues from an environmental, economic and social point of view. I am keen to continue developing my knowledge and contribute to finding solutions which build a more resilient environment and supportive society. I also worked on a biodynamic farm for a couple of months, seeing first hand the benefits and challenges of closed-loop farming.
